				<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><span style="font-family: georgia, palatino; font-size: medium;"><em><a href="http://www.thrillmesoftly.com/2013/05/fast-five/fastfive/" rel="attachment wp-att-9847"><img class="alignright size-full wp-image-9847" alt="fastfive" src="http://www.thrillmesoftly.com/wp-content/uploads/fastfive.jpg" width="94" height="140" /></a>Dominic, Brian and Mia (Vin Diesel, Paul Walker, Jordana Brewster) are on the lam in Rio de Janeiro where they make enemies with a local crime lord… and are hunted by a zealous federal agent (Dwayne Johnson).</em> A turning point in this franchise, resulting in a very intense heist movie with the occasional street racing scene rather than the other way around. That idea apparently gave the filmmakers a shot of adrenaline because the film is chock-full of brilliant action, including an insane chase involving a huge bank vault (!). Johnson joins this reunion of familiar faces from earlier entries… and he&#8217;s welcome.</span></p>

<p><span style="font-family: georgia, palatino; font-size: medium;"><em><a href="http://www.thrillmesoftly.com/2013/05/the-sitter/thesitter/" rel="attachment wp-att-9715"><img class="alignright size-full wp-image-9715" alt="thesitter" src="http://www.thrillmesoftly.com/wp-content/uploads/thesitter.jpg" width="94" height="139" /></a>Slacker Noah Griffith (Jonah Hill) is talked into babysitting three kids for a friend of his mom&#8217;s, but the night turns into a wild adventure.</em> The director of <a href="http://www.thrillmesoftly.com/2009/08/pineapple-express/"><b>Pineapple Express</b></a> (2008) delivers another mad romp, an <b>Adventures in Babysitting</b> (1987) for a new decade. It&#8217;s a very busy film, with drug deals, chases, a romance and three kids who are all annoying in different ways. Lively, with one or two funny scenes, but exhausting. A lack of likable characters leads to indifference.</span></p>

<p><span style="font-family: georgia, palatino; font-size: medium;"><em><a href="http://www.thrillmesoftly.com/2013/05/jeff-who-lives-at-home/jeffwholivesathome/" rel="attachment wp-att-9710"><img class="alignright size-full wp-image-9710" alt="jeffwholivesathome" src="http://www.thrillmesoftly.com/wp-content/uploads/jeffwholivesathome.jpg" width="90" height="140" /></a>30-year-old Jeff (Jason Segel) has no job or girlfriend and lives in his mom&#8217;s (Susan Sarandon) basement in Baton Rouge, Louisiana… but his mother and brother (Ed Helms) have problems of their own.</em> The Duplass brothers went a little more mainstream with this comedy after the experimental <b>Puffy Chair</b> (2005). Its portrayal of a family whose lives aren&#8217;t going anywhere is warm, amusing and thoughtful – a study of dreams, desire and bad habits, with a sprinkling of serendipity. Cute and engaging, with terrific performances, but perhaps a little too slight.</span></p>

<p><span style="font-family: georgia, palatino; font-size: medium;"><em><a href="http://www.thrillmesoftly.com/2013/05/this-means-war/thismeanswar/" rel="attachment wp-att-9699"><img class="alignright size-full wp-image-9699" alt="thismeanswar" src="http://www.thrillmesoftly.com/wp-content/uploads/thismeanswar.jpg" width="95" height="140" /></a>CIA agents and best friends FDR Foster and Tuck Hansen (Chris Pine, Tom Hardy) start dating the same woman (Reese Witherspoon) without realizing it and soon turn it into a mindless contest.</em> McG returns to <a href="http://www.thrillmesoftly.com/2003/03/charlies-angels/"><b>Charlie&#8217;s Angels </b></a>territory with this romantic action-comedy, but he should have moved on. The cartoonish shootouts, fistfights and car chases are good for a few thrills. Pine and Hardy give it their best shot as the handsome and very competitive spies, but the film needs a far lighter touch (and better jokes) than McG and his crew are able to deliver.</span></p>

<p><em><a href="http://www.thrillmesoftly.com/2013/05/happy-go-lucky/happygolucky/" rel="attachment wp-att-9661"><img class="alignright size-full wp-image-9661" alt="happygolucky" src="http://www.thrillmesoftly.com/wp-content/uploads/happygolucky.jpg" width="94" height="140" /></a><span style="font-family: georgia, palatino; font-size: medium;">30-year-old London primary school teacher Pauline &#8220;Poppy&#8221; Cross (Sally Hawkins) always looks at the bright side of life, but her driving instructor (Eddie Marsan) poses a very special challenge.</span></em><span style="font-family: georgia, palatino; font-size: medium;"> It&#8217;s hard not to find Poppy a nuisance, with her constant silly jokes and seeming inability to take anything seriously. But in the hands of Mike Leigh, who knows how to make a film like this ring true, she slowly grows on us and we realize that she does take responsibility and is a much more attractive human being than many others in her life. Leigh makes us think about our daily prejudices, and the intense showdowns between Hawkins and Marsan are spellbinding.</span></p>

<p><span style="font-family: georgia, palatino; font-size: medium;"><em><a href="http://www.thrillmesoftly.com/2013/05/dark-shadows/darkshadows/" rel="attachment wp-att-9642"><img class="alignright size-full wp-image-9642" alt="darkshadows" src="http://www.thrillmesoftly.com/wp-content/uploads/darkshadows.jpg" width="94" height="140" /></a>In 1972, a vampire (Johnny Depp) is accidentally freed from his buried coffin and returns to his Maine family mansion; a lot has changed in 200 years, but the witch who turned him into a bloodsucker is still around.</em> A very Tim Burton-esque adaptation of the classic 1966-1971 horror soap, complete with opulent production design, amusing clashes between the &#8217;70s and the 1700s, and a magnificent Depp who&#8217;s pale only in his complexion. Very similar to many other Burton films (especially <a href="http://www.thrillmesoftly.com/2009/08/beetle-juice/"><b>Beetle Juice</b></a>), and the fiery climax is expected and weak, but the movie is still funny and looks great.</span></p>

<p><em><a href="http://www.thrillmesoftly.com/2013/05/star-trek-into-darkness/startrekintodarkness/" rel="attachment wp-att-9606"><img class="alignright size-full wp-image-9606" alt="startrekintodarkness" src="http://www.thrillmesoftly.com/wp-content/uploads/startrekintodarkness.jpg" width="94" height="139" /></a><span style="font-family: georgia, palatino; font-size: medium;">After an attack on Starfleet headquarters in San Francisco, the main suspect (Benedict Cumberbatch) hides on Klingon territory and is pursued by a vengeful Kirk (Chris Pine) and his crew.</span></em><span style="font-family: georgia, palatino; font-size: medium;"> The sequel to <a href="http://www.thrillmesoftly.com/2009/04/star-trek-not-quite-warp-speed-yet/"><b>Star Trek </b></a>(2009) is equally impressive, boasting beautiful visual effects (now in 3D that looks great even though it was added in post), plenty of thrills and a cast that seems even more comfortable in their iconic roles this second time round. An icy Cumberbatch is wickedly entertaining as the head villain. The script connects with episodes of the original <i>Star Trek</i> as well as <a href="http://www.thrillmesoftly.com/2003/11/star-trek-ii-the-wrath-of-khan/"><b>Star Trek II </b></a>(1982), sometimes deftly, sometimes lazily. </span></p>

<p><a href="http://www.thrillmesoftly.com/2013/05/apollo-13-lost-moon-saved-lives/apollo13/" rel="attachment wp-att-9598"><img class="alignright size-full wp-image-9598" alt="apollo13" src="http://www.thrillmesoftly.com/wp-content/uploads/apollo13.jpg" width="89" height="140" /></a><span style="font-family: georgia, palatino; font-size: medium;">When producer Brian Grazer and director Ron Howard decided to turn the story about the ill-fated 1972 Apollo 13 mission into a movie, they found a lot of support from NASA. The space agency, likely eager to exploit the goodwill surrounding the rescue of the mission&#8217;s three astronauts, even offered Howard a chance to film the Mission Control sequences in the actual facilities in Houston, Texas. The spacecraft interiors were designed in Kansas by the same manufacturers who worked on the original Apollo 13 command module. The actors were given access to the Space Camp in Alabama and the Johnson Space Center in Houston. Where does one draw the line between independent filmmaking and NASA propaganda? </span></p>
<p><span style="font-family: georgia, palatino; font-size: medium;">Three years after Neil Armstrong&#8217;s first steps on the moon, the American public has grown jaded with lunar expeditions. By the time Jim Lovell (Tom Hanks), Fred Haise (Bill Paxton) and Ken Mattingly (Gary Sinise) are cleared for the Apollo 13 mission, there is no real excitement. Lovell&#8217;s wife Marilyn (Kathleen Quinlan) has bad dreams about the expedition and just wants it over. Then, unfortunately, it turns out that Mattingly has been exposed to the measles, and since NASA can&#8217;t take any chances, he&#8217;s replaced by Jack Swigert (Kevin Bacon). A few days after liftoff, a liquid oxygen tank explodes and another turns out to be leaking. It is soon clear that the crew of Apollo 13 and NASA are going to have to forget about the moon and focus on how to get the spacecraft back to Earth in one piece… </span></p>
<p><span style="font-family: georgia, palatino; font-size: medium;"><strong>Technically believable and dazzling</strong></span><br />
<span style="font-family: georgia, palatino; font-size: medium;">&#8220;Lost Moon&#8221;, Lovell and Jeffrey Kluger&#8217;s chronicle of the Apollo 13 accident and rescue, provides much of the backbone of this technically believable and dazzling film, one of the best ever to portray a historical space program event. It&#8217;s easy to think of it as a failure, but in light of the horrific Challenger and Columbia disasters in 1986 and 2003, it is amazing how those astronauts were brought back to safety. Everything in the film, from the smallest 1970s period details to the meticulously constructed modules to the visual effects that bring the Apollo 13 liftoff to life looks impressive. As for that last part, the sequence may have its flaws to modern audiences, but it still provides one of the absolute highlights of the film because of the tension that Howard builds and the stirring emotions of James Horner&#8217;s music; as the Saturn V rocket lifts to the sky with great thunder and the camera targets one of the astronauts&#8217; wives whose intense fear is relieved with a tear, I felt the hairs on my arms stand up. Nothing that follows is equally powerful, but still very engaging, which is quite a feat considering how technically complex every problem that befell Apollo 13 were. The filmmakers are very good at conveying just how claustrophobic and eerie it must have been up in the module, with the embracing cold and darkness. Ed Harris delivers a forceful performance as Gene Krantz, the Flight Director whose white vest became so legendary it is now an item at the National Air and Space Museum in Washington; he&#8217;s more than ably aided by a terrific cast that also includes some of Howard&#8217;s closest family. Horner&#8217;s score is one of the composer&#8217;s best, including the end title track that features special vocals by Annie Lennox. </span></p>
<p><span style="font-family: georgia, palatino; font-size: medium;">What about that initial question I posed? The answer is, yes, this is perfect PR for NASA… but it&#8217;s also one of those times where the collaboration serves a higher purpose. The artistic qualities of <b>Apollo 13 </b>would have suffered without NASA&#8217;s involvement. Sometimes, the end justifies the means.</span></p>
